Resumen

La diálisis peritoneal, como tratamiento sustitutivo de la función renal, se basa en la instilación dentro de la cavidad peritoneal de soluciones de diálisis con el objeto de aprovechar algunas de las propiedades del peritoneo como membrana biológica, con el fin de eliminar las sustancias de desecho generadas diariamente por nuestro organismo y contribuir entre otros con el control del balance hidrosalino alterado en la insuficiencia renal.
